Transaction 88c8d8e3f1dc12f5fcf35a100d15a91e8d3975cd6c0d685781ceddea063df012

block
26d9e8046a92482f64ece770158a5c05cc8d9c0246b5485a91c90bcfeb386b62

1 Input

23 Outputs